It's Dazzling

The shimmer through your swirling hair, 

That playful glint within your stare

That wishful shine upon those lips,

Oh, it's dazzling! 

The thoughtful wrinkle upon your brow, 

That charge that makes your eyes say "Wow!"

The honesty in your welcome smile,

Oh, so dazzling!

Is this love that burns my soul? 

One look at you and I feel whole.

But I can't share this with you at all.

 

You speak to me as a dear friend, 

But never look beyond that end.

I long to claim oh so much more!

Lord, it's dazzling! 

In my dreams you've held me tight, 

Yet I'm not worthy of that right.

Your shining star so humbles me!

Oh, it's dazzling!

Is this love that burns my soul? 

One look at you and I feel whole.

Dare I risk sharing this with you at all?

 

I can not see how to overcome 

The blinding chasm that keeps me from

Forging that great bond with you!

Oh, it's dazzling!

How could I risk losing what you give, 

Dear friendship for as long as I live,

But to never hope to have it all?

Oh, that's dazzling!

Is this love that burns my soul? 

One look at you and I feel whole.

Can I spend one more day without your heart?

— Words and music copyright September 2012, Kirby Lee Davis
